Open Door Community Outreach Center Completes Toilet Facility Project in Kwakwaduam

Open Door Community Outreach Center is pleased to announce the successful completion of a toilet facility project in Kwakwaduam, a rural community in the Eastern Region of Ghana. This initiative forms part of our continued commitment to improving living conditions and promoting healthier communities through sustainable development projects.

Addressing a Critical Community Need

Access to proper sanitation remains a significant challenge in many rural communities across Ghana. In Kwakwaduam, the lack of adequate toilet facilities posed serious health and environmental concerns, contributing to poor hygiene practices and increasing the risk of sanitation-related diseases.

Recognizing this urgent need, Open Door Community Outreach Center initiated the construction of a modern toilet facility to provide residents with safe, hygienic, and accessible sanitation services.

Project Completion and Community Impact

The toilet facility has now been successfully completed and officially handed over to the Kwakwaduam community for public use.

This project is expected to make a meaningful impact by:

  • Improving sanitation and hygiene standards
  • Reducing open defecation within the community
  • Preventing the spread of sanitation-related illnesses
  • Promoting dignity, safety, and healthier living conditions for residents

By providing this essential facility, we are helping create a cleaner and healthier environment for families, children, and future generations.
